The Role: 

Role & Responsibilities:   

Account Manager manages the day-to-day activities to creatively execute and produce client marketing programs. They communicate externally with the client and internally with the project team to keep everyone informed of project status, updates, and changes. 

Essential Duties:  

  • Build relationships with clients based on trust and credibility. 
  • Collaborate with clients, Account senior leaders, strategy, and creative departments to develop creative briefs that solve for client’s marketing challenge. 
  • Serve as the creative and exceptional leader for new, more extensive scale and/or more complex marketing programs.  
  • Lead the day-to-day creative development from start to finish; secure required client approvals (e.g. creative briefs, budgets, creative materials, etc.); ensure progressive steps in the process are approved with adequate time to meet schedules. 
  • Guide internal and client meetings, presentations, and calls; prepare relevant documents, including agendas, presentation decks, and follow-up communications, etc. 
  • Evaluate copy, layouts, artwork, media plans, and production materials and make suggested revisions in keeping with agreed-upon strategies and business objectives. 
  • Keep agency team informed of client requests and changes; anticipate potential problems and potential implications; proactively develop and execute solutions. 
  • Proactively contribute to managing project scope and budget; notify manager of client requests that fall outside of scope; alert client of financial and timing implications; secure client approval to proceed and revise budgets as needed. 
  • Analyse program results, summarize findings and recommend program enhancements and/or changes to improve going forward. 
  • Assist senior leadership in developing program recaps and associated presentations for clients based on analysis of results and recommendations. 
  • Monitor the status of work-in-progress and client budgets; lead internal status meetings with finance and project management; review estimates/billing and approve invoices. 

Education: 

  • Scientific Degree completed with Marketing/Economics specialization. 
  • 2 years' experience in the industry. 

Skills: 

  • Level of English: fluent. 
  • Proficiency in MS Office Tools, especially Excel and PowerPoint. The knowledge of CRM tools will be considered a plus. 
  • Communication – both written and spoken. 
  • Comprehensive and current knowledge of the Agency’s offerings and industry trends. 
  • Ability to understand client needs and handle the negotiation
